Introduction
Big storms hit New Jersey. Many people lost power. Some trains stopped and one person died.

Main Body
The storms started on Friday. Many trees fell. One tree hit a car. A man died and a woman went to the hospital.

Trains have many problems. Some train lines are closed. Other trains are slow. The company is using buses to help people move.

Many people had no electricity. Now, fewer people have this problem. The Governor wants to fix the power and the trains quickly.

Conclusion
Workers are still fixing the trains and the power in the state.

Vocabulary Learning
⚡️ The 'Action' Shift
Look at how the story changes from Past (what happened) to Present (what is happening now).
1. Yesterday's News (Past)
- The storms started → Something began.
- Many trees fell → They went down.
- A man died → It happened and finished.
2. Right Now (Present)
- The company is using buses → They are doing it at this moment.
- Workers are still fixing → The job is not finished yet.
💡 Simple Rule: Use -ed for things that are over. Use is/are + -ing for things that are still moving.
